ANN ARBOR, Mich. - Michimich -- As the winter months set in and many individuals struggle to stay motivated or maintain healthy routines, the Japanese Martial Arts Center (JMAC) in Ann Arbor is encouraging the community to find renewed energy, focus, and confidence through martial arts training.
With shorter days and colder weather often contributing to seasonal fatigue or low mood, maintaining structure and consistency becomes increasingly important. Martial arts provides not only physical activity but also mental discipline and a supportive community—three key elements for overall wellbeing.
Finding Strength in Structure
Martial arts training offers a foundation of structure and accountability. When students commit to regular classes, they stay engaged, focused, and active—even during the most challenging times of the year.
At JMAC, students of all ages are encouraged to set and pursue tangible goals as they advance through the ranks. Each milestone—whether mastering a new technique or earning a higher belt—helps build self-confidence, resilience, and a lasting sense of accomplishment.

A Healthy Outlet for Stress
Beyond physical skill, martial arts also serves as a safe and empowering outlet for stress. Each punch, kick, and kata provides an opportunity to release tension and channel energy into focus and control. The result is a calmer mind, stronger body, and more balanced outlook.
Students often find that their time in the dojo becomes a highlight of their week—a space to disconnect from daily pressures and reconnect with themselves.
